Each Wednesday, the U.S. Army Marksmanship Unit publishes a reloading how-to article on the USAMU Facebook page. Yesterday's Handloading Hump Day post covered preparation of once-fired 5.56x45mm brass. This article, the first in a 3-part series, has many useful tips. If you shoot a rifle chambered in .223 Rem or 5.56x45mm, this article is worth reading.
